> Question. Should I use IIS? Or can I get away with using no other
> webserver besides tomcat's coyote?

Whatever suites your fancy honestly. If you're using another language like ASP or PHP you'll want to use IIS in front. If you're using a control panel of any kind you'll want to run a web server that's compatible with it as most (all?) don't support Tomcat directly.

If you're just running CFML and don't need any IIS features, I hear Tomcat's web server is quite fast when used on it's own.
